## What changed? When trying to clean up some PRs for worker callbacks, I noticed some unnecessary duplication and cruft in our testcases for completion handlers. Essentially it's this: <img width="567" height="216" alt="image" src="https://github.com/user-attachments/assets/c64b759c-c5be-4fc3-a346-92cf77e1f6db" /> Rather than having N places where we construct a `completionHandler` and several implementations of spinning up an `httptest` webserver, we now just have a single `newNexusCompletionHandler` function that does both. ## Why? Remove boilerplate, making tests more concise and easier to read. ## How did you test it? - [x] built - [x] run locally and tested manually - [ ] covered by existing tests - [ ] added new unit test(s) - [ ] added new functional test(s) ## Potential risks If there was some subtle behavioral change this could undermine our testing.
